Explain the three different dispersion patterns.

Biology
1 answer:
Nostrana [21]3 years ago
8 0

Individuals of a population can be distributed in one of three basic patterns: they can be more or less equally spaced apart (uniform dispersion), dispersed randomly with no predictable pattern (random dispersion), or clustered in groups (clumped dispersion).

5.How does temperature change affect surface tension?
dybincka [34]
Surface tension decreases when temperature increases because cohesive forces decrease with an increase of molecular thermal activity
